Sports Director
Application Deadline: April 7, 2025Job Title: Sports Director Reports to: Recreation Commission Director Position Summary: Under the direction of the Augusta Recreation Commission Director, the Sports Director is responsible for development, planning, organizing, coordinating, and supervising community and recreation programs. This position will supervise part-time staff and volunteers. They will develop partnerships with administrators from Augusta-USD 402, the City of Augusta, and other community groups/organizations to provide a variety of programs that enhance the community. M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S: • Must be able to provide proof of U.S. citizenship or legal right to work in the United States. • Must be 18 years of age or older. Education: • A Bachelor’s Degree from an accredited college or university with major course work in recreation administration or related field and/or related experience. Duties and Responsibilities: • Responsible for organizing, scheduling facilities, and all aspects of sports programs for youth and adult participants. • Ability to train coaches, officials, scorekeepers, and site supervisors. • Ability to officiate when necessary. • Ability to work independently and without direct supervision. • Ability to work with patrons and staff and exercise good judgment when interacting with people. • Physically capable of performing duties, walking, running, lifting up to 50 lbs., and any other physical work that may need to be done. • A good understanding of computers: word, excel, publisher, and internet use. • Ability to write letters, make fliers, and basic bookkeeping duties. • Inform Recreation Commission Director of daily operational needs, problems, and player/parent feedback. • Ability to follow budgetary guidelines and all financial responsibilities associated with the sports programs. • Responsible for sports staff time sheets. • Perform other duties as assigned by the Recreation Commission Director. Certifications: • CPR and First Aid certified, or the willingness to obtain certification upon employment. • Must have a valid driver’s license. Hours: This position will require some evenings and weekends. Normal business hours are Monday – Friday from 8:00am – 5:00pm. Hours will be adjusted as not to overload the individual. Pay Scale: $40,000 - $50,000 DOE
